  Case: Divorced and double
One of my students has parents that are divorced. Each parent wants two sets of every paper I send home. This includes homework. I can tell that each parent wants to be the main parent and have the student do all of the homework with them. I can tell that the student does not like this because she is now having to do double the homework. Do I say something to the parents or just stay out.
Solution: (Rates are posted for this solution!)
I would suggest a communication app in which you can take one picture of the paper and send it to both parents. This seems to be an issue seen often and I believe both parents are entitled to the information. Does a physical paper need to go home to both, but a quick picture and message sent will alleviate any complaints in the end.
